The basics
Who are the camps and training for?
Boys and girls ages 12-17, all levels. Camps split into 3 ability groups (beginner to competitive) after evaluation. Private sessions adapt to the player no matter the starting point.
What languages?
Coaching in French and English. Pick one, or we alternate based on the group.
Where do activities take place?
The July 2026 camp is in Montreal. Private and small-group sessions run in Greater Montreal. Camps outside Quebec (Canada / USA) are possible on a group request basis.
What should my kid bring?
Clean basketball shoes, athletic gear, a water bottle, and a good attitude. The 2 B100L t-shirts are included in the camp.
Payment & e-Transfer
How do I pay?
By Interac e-Transfer only. You reserve your spot online and receive payment instructions (email, security question, hint) by email and in your parent account. The spot is locked in once payment is received.
When is payment due?
Camp: at the latest 48 hours before the camp starts. Private or small-group session: at the latest 48 hours before the requested time. An automatic reminder is sent close to the deadline.
Why only e-Transfer?
No card-processing fees added to your bill, and 100% of the amount goes straight to the program. Simpler, cleaner.
Are camps eligible for Relevé 24?
Yes — Basketball 100 Limites camps are eligible for Quebec's refundable tax credit for youth physical activity. Your Relevé 24 slip will be issued for tax filing. Up to 78% of the cost can be returned depending on family income.
Cancellation & refunds
What happens if I don't pay on time?
A reminder is sent automatically at the due date. Without payment received within 24 hours after the reminder, the reservation is automatically cancelled and the spot is offered to the waitlist. You can re-book while spots remain.
Camp cancellation policy?
More than 5 days before the camp starts: full cash refund. Less than 5 days before, but before the camp begins: 50% cash refund. After the camp starts: no refund. Payment is due 5 days before start; without payment by then, the spot is automatically released.
And for a private or small-group session?
More than 5 days before the session: full cash refund. Less than 5 days before, but before the session starts: 50% cash refund. After the session: no refund. Same rule as camps.
What if Basketball 100 Limites cancels?
If B100L cancels a private or small-group session: full cash refund or free reschedule, family's choice. Camps are not normally cancelled; in case of exceptional force majeure (public health, loss of venue, etc.), the same options apply.
Safety & coaching
Who supervises the kids?
Maxime Louis-Jean leads every session. OUA champion 2026 (TMU), Player of the Game in the 2026 national semi-final. For camps, qualified assistant coaches (current or former university players) support the staff.
Is there a waiver to sign?
Yes — every parent must accept the liability waiver and parental consent before the first activity. You can read it anytime on the site.
First aid?
A first-aid kit is on site at every session. In a medical emergency, the parent is contacted immediately and emergency services are called as needed.
Image rights?
Photos and videos may be taken for the website and social media. You can refuse this consent by email at any time — the waiver details it.
